Abstract

Healthy individuals have a greater capacity to work productively and creatively, which will impact the quality of human resources. This study examines factors that can influence revisit intention, exercise adherence, and word of mouth among members of a clubhouse in Tangerang. The study was conducted quantitatively on 227 respondents who are members of KYZN Clubhouse using a purposive sampling technique. The results show that service quality, service convenience, and exercise satisfaction are factors that can influence word of mouth intention, as well as service quality and exercise satisfaction that can influence revisit intention, and service convenience and exercise satisfaction can influence exercise adherence. It is recommended that companies can pay attention to these three aspects, especially service quality, because it is the most important factor in influencing members' revisit intention.
